Big BitsStudio was asked to design and build a WWII twin sized P-47d airplane bed for a themed bedroom. Part 2 of this build shows how we went from a foam and plywood frame to the finished upholstered bed.
We fiberglassed the foam and plywood in a heated room. After everything cured, we took it to Myers Upholstery and upholstered the bed, along with all the finishing touches before the airplane bed left the shop.
